How it works

Think of calcium as a master regulator for your muscles and bones. It supports bone mineralization, helping to maintain bone density, and it aids neuromuscular relaxation, which is essential for proper muscle function and nerve signaling [NIH ODS]. Without adequate calcium, your body may pull it from your bones, which can weaken them over time [NIH ODS].

Safety profile

FDA received a total of 592,059 adverse event reports across all supplement categories, but specific report counts for this product are not available [FDA data]. Regarding calcium specifically, high intakes might increase the risk of heart disease and prostate cancer [NIH ODS]. Side effects from very high calcium levels include constipation, nausea, weight loss, extreme tiredness, frequent need to urinate, abnormal heart rhythms, and a high risk of death from heart disease [NIH ODS]. Calcium can also reduce the absorption of several medications, including bisphosphonates, tetracycline antibiotics, fluoroquinolone antibiotics, levothyroxine, and phenytoin [NIH ODS].

How to Read This Label

Supplement labels contain several key sections regulated by the FDA:

  • Serving Size — The recommended amount per dose. Always check this — some products require multiple capsules per serving.
  • Amount Per Serving — Shows the quantity of each nutrient in the product, typically in IU (International Units), mg (milligrams), or mcg (micrograms).
  • % Daily Value (%DV) — Indicates how much a nutrient in a serving contributes to a daily diet. 5% DV or less is low; 20% DV or more is high.
  • Other Ingredients — Lists inactive ingredients like fillers, binders, and capsule materials (e.g., gelatin, cellulose, magnesium stearate).
  • Suggested Use — The manufacturer's recommended directions for taking the supplement, including timing and dosage.
